Design and Test of Operation Parameter Monitoring System for Deep Ploughing and Subsoiling
Journal Title: 河南科技大学学报(自然科学版) - Year 2018, Vol 39, Issue 5
Abstract
In view of the lack of effective monitoring means for the operation area and operation quality of deep ploughing and subsoiling, a new method of detecting operation quality parameters based on satellite positioning and wireless communication was proposed.The mathematical model was constructed, and the operation depth was detected by using angle sensor.The information parameters such as operation position, operation speed and operation area were measured by satellite positioning technology.The data path and wireless communication processes were designed.The test system was set up based on Linux system.The test results show that when the depth of ploughing is 33 cm and the average depth of ploughing is 32.5 cm, the variance only is 1.98.The average control rate of tillage area is 97.65%, and the minimum control rate is 95%, which satisfies the requirements of system design.
